Safety and Effectiveness of Adding Saquinavir (FORTOVASE) in Soft Gel Capsule Form to an Anti-HIV Drug Combination in HIV-Infected Patients

The purpose of this study is to see if it is safe and effective to give saquinavir (as a soft gel capsule taken by mouth) along with 2 other anti-HIV drugs to HIV-infected patients.

About this study

Prior to initiation of study treatment all patients are screened and baseline lab values are taken. Patients then receive the study treatment, FORTOVASE, two times a day plus 2 new NRTI's. Assessments will be performed at specified intervals throughout the duration of treatment.

Inclusion criteria

You may be eligible for this study if you:

  • Are HIV-positive.
  • Have an HIV count of 5,000 copies/ml or more.
  • Have a CD4 count of 100 cells/mm3 or more.
  • Meet specific requirements if you have ever taken NRTIs.
  • Are 16 - 64 years old (need consent if under 18).
  • Agree to use effective methods of birth control during the study.

Exclusion criteria

You will not be eligible for this study if you:

  • Have taken non-nucleoside reverse transcriptase inhibitors (NNRTIs) or protease inhibitors (PIs) for more than 2 weeks.
  • Have taken all the available NRTIs.
  • Have certain serious medical conditions, including severe liver disease or active opportunistic (AIDS-related) infection.
  • Have a history of weight loss, muscle pain, and loss of appetite.
  • Have taken certain medications, including anti-HIV drugs other than those required by this study.
  • Are pregnant or breast-feeding.
  • Abuse alcohol or drugs.
  • Are unable to complete the study for any reason.
